Hagia Sophia: what to know before you go

Fifteen centuries of history, an active mosque, and a visit that takes an hour if you time it right.

What you are actually looking at

Completed in 537 under Justinian as the largest cathedral in the world, converted to a mosque in 1453, made a museum in 1935 and returned to worship in 2020. The dome, 31 metres across and seemingly unsupported, rewrote what architecture was thought capable of.

Practicalities that matter

It functions as a mosque, so visiting pauses during the five daily prayers, shoulders and knees must be covered, and women cover their hair, scarves are available at the entrance. Shoes come off at the carpeted area.

When to go

First thing in the morning or late afternoon. Midday between 11:00 and 15:00 brings tour groups and long queues, particularly from May to September.

What to look for

The Deesis mosaic in the upper gallery, the Viking runes carved into a marble parapet, the weeping column, and the calligraphic roundels, the layers of two religions and three empires sitting on top of each other.
